The video discusses recent market trends, focusing on investor behavior in equity and bond markets. It highlights the impact of Fed rate hike expectations on the yield curve and explores the economic uncertainty caused by the banking system. The discussion also covers potential investment strategies in light of these economic conditions, emphasizing a cautious approach in the short term and a recovery-focused strategy in the long term.
